PROSSER v. ROSS

No. 94-3607.

70 F.3d 1005 (1995)

Christopher Lee PROSSER, Appellee, v. Davis L. ROSS, CO I,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, Eighth Circuit.

Decided December 1, 1995.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Alana Maria Barragan-Scott, Assistant Attorney General, Jefferson City, Missouri, argued (Orval E. Jones, on the brief), for appellant.

Richard Beaver, Jefferson City, Missouri, argued, for appellee.

Before WOLLMAN, JOHN R. GIBSON, and MORRIS SHEPPARD ARNOLD, Circuit Judges.


MORRIS SHEPPARD ARNOLD, Circuit Judge.

David Ross appeals the district court's denial of his motion for summary judgment on his defense of qualified immunity. We reverse.
